2, What is SMT?
SMT (Surface Mount Technology), also known as surface mounting technology, refers to a technology that installs electronic components such as resistors, capacitors, transistors, and volume circuits onto the surface of a circuit board (PCB). Surface soldering is mainly done by printing Solder Paste on the circuit board to be soldered, placing electronic components, melting the paste at high temperature, allowing the paste to coat the electronic components, and when the temperature cools and solidifies, surface soldering is completed.


3, What are the differences between SMT, SMD, SMA and SME?
These three words are all closely related to SMT. In simple terms, SMT is a soldering technology, SMD and SMA are electronic components to be soldered, and SME is the soldering machine.

Abbreviation, full name, Chinese explanation
SMT Surface Mount Technology is the technology of installing electronic components on the surface of a circuit board
SMD Surface Mount Device (SMT) is a single electronic component installed on the surface of a circuit board, such as resistors, capacitors, and integrated circuits
SMA Surface Mount Assembly (SMT) is an electronic component installed on the surface of a circuit board, and this component contains one or more combinations of electronic components, such as Bluetooth modules and WIFI modules
SME Surface Mount Equipment is a machine that installs SMDS on the surface of circuit boards


4, SMT production process
To successfully install electronic components on a circuit board through SMT, mainly three processes need to be gone through:

Process description: Use the equipment
Solder paste printing
Print solder paste at the positions on the PCB where electronic components need to be installed with a solder paste printer
2. Make a patch
Place electronic components at the positions where solder paste is printed on the PCB with a component placement machine
3. Re-welding heating
Through the reflow oven heating, the solder paste on the PCB is melted to connect and fix the electronic components to the PCB in the reflow oven


5, Advantages of SMT Technology
The biggest difference between SMT and the previous through-hole mounting technology is that SMT does not require reserving through-holes for the pins of electronic components, thus allowing for the use of smaller electronic components. There are mainly the following three advantages for electronic products to adopt SMT technology:

1. Thinner and lighter in size:
By using smaller electronic components, the required circuit board area will also decrease, and the volume of electronic products can become lighter.

2. More high-end products:
When electronic components become smaller and thinner, electronic products can be applied to more diverse fields, such as micro-robots, cpus, portable electronic products, etc., and more precise and high-end products can be designed.

3. Easier mass production:
SMT uses machinery and equipment to complete surface soldering. Compared with the manual insertion operation in the past, it is more suitable for mass production, and the manufacturing process is also more stable than through-hole insertion.


6, Introduction to SMT Equipment

Dispensing machine

SMT equipment recommendation - The dispensing machine is used to precisely dot, inject, apply and drip liquid to the correct position of the product. It can be used for dotting, drawing lines, circular or arc-shaped shapes. This model is patented for the Automatic Process Calibration Injection Technology (CPJ), which can automatically compensate for the viscosity of the colloid to maintain a fixed amount of glue. It will also automatically measure the weight of each glue point and adjust the pressure to maintain the consistency of the glue amount for each component

Fully automatic solder paste printing machine
SMT Equipment Introduction - The fully automatic solder paste printer is a fully automatic model. After setting the relevant parameters, it can automatically feed in the board, align, print solder paste, and discharge the board. It can automatically optically correct the printing position. The printing accuracy is ±12.5. The two-stage waiting mode can reduce the machine's transportation time. It supports multiple printing demolding modes and can select the best printing conditions for different parts.

Nitrogen reflow soldering furnace
Professional SMT equipment - nitrogen reflow oven
Uniformly heated gas is provided to melt the solder paste, allowing electronic components to be connected to the circuit board. Compared with the common reflow oven, the nitrogen reflow oven can effectively reduce the bubbles at the solder joints and avoid thermal damage to power devices at a high-quality level.

Chip placement machine
SMT equipment application - A surface mount technology (SMT) placement machine is a device that accurately places electronic components on a PCB by moving the placement head. It can identify various types of component patterns and place components at high speed and high precision. It is divided into two sections, with each section consisting of two tables for CHIP processing. Each Table is equipped with 12 suction nozzles, capable of simultaneously processing 12 CHIP components.

Selective wave soldering
SMT product equipment - Selective wave soldering is used in through-hole mounting processes. By taking advantage of the easy movement of small nozzles, the PCB is fixed on the rack, and the nozzles are moved to bring the solder solution into contact with the solder pins of electronic components. The tin pot and tin pump system can move freely in the X/Y/Z axis directions, and the entire process can precisely control the tin eating position through the program.

Welding selection machine
High-quality SMT equipment - adjustable PCB positioning frame of the soldering machine, two tin POTS with independent Z-axis control, increase the flexibility of soldering, and two nozzles of different sizes can be used according to different solder joints.

Automatic soldering machine
The automated SMT equipment - the automatic soldering machine is an automated soldering device that can significantly save the time for replacing fixtures. During the soldering process, it can simultaneously position the products to be soldered. It is equipped with a soldering iron thermometer to measure the temperature and make corrections based on the actual temperature. It is also equipped with a built-in temperature check system. If the temperature is abnormal, it cannot act. Automatic pneumatic nozzles and roller brushes can also be used to clean the soldering iron tip.

Selective coating/dispensing system
Taiwan SMT equipment - Selective coating/dispensing system is used to precisely spray liquids and colloids onto the correct positions of products, providing a stable amount of adhesive for a wide range of PCBS, BGA, etc. The mechanical drive mechanism with XYZ repeatability accuracy of 25 microns can flexibly perform conformal coating and dispensing.
